Almost every major change has hurt newer players more than older players in the sense that it prevents newer players from doing something that older players have done. Yes, that sucks a lot. It's one of the major things people dislike about this server.

But it's also one of the major reasons for the growth of the server anyway. People come here for a retail-like experience. That means not having all that QoL or 'easy' stuff. And we've had less of that as time went on, and people like that. It might burn some to know that we -used- to have stuff that made things easier, but people have to get over that.

And as time moves on, the benefit that players had from old systems fades away, as everyone is forced to do things the right way. We all want a legitimate experience, and the only way to get that is to do these "reverse blue shells" once in a while, unfortunately.
